Understanding the Issue
When you receive a product that is not as advertised—such as an old or outdated version—it may be due to:

  • Packaging Errors: Mistakes during order processing can result in the wrong item being shipped.
  • Deliberate Substitution: In some cases, sellers might substitute the ordered product with an older version or a cheaper alternative.
  • Miscommunication: Sometimes, discrepancies arise due to unclear product descriptions or images.

Steps to Take If You Receive a Different, Old Product

  1. Document the Product
    • Take clear photographs of the received product, including any packaging or labels.
    • Note down details that highlight the differences between what was advertised and what was delivered.
  2. Review Your Order Confirmation
    • Compare the details of your order confirmation (such as product specifications, model numbers, etc.) with the product you received.
    • Identify any discrepancies that can support your case.
  3. Contact the Seller or Retailer
    • Reach out to the seller’s customer support via phone, email, or live chat.
    • Clearly explain that you received a different or outdated product and request a resolution, such as a refund or a replacement with the correct item.
    • Provide all your documentation (photos, order details, etc.) to support your claim.
  4. Request a Formal Resolution
    • If the initial contact does not resolve your issue, request a formal complaint process or escalation.
    • Ask for clear instructions on how to return the incorrect product if needed and details on your refund or replacement.
  5. Seek External Help if Necessary
    • If the seller is unresponsive or unwilling to resolve the issue, consider filing a complaint with consumer protection agencies.

Customer Care Assistance
For added support during this process, consider these tips:

  • Check Seller Policies: Read through the seller’s return and refund policies to understand your rights.
  • Keep a Record: Maintain a detailed log of all communications, including dates, names, and responses.
  • Use Official Channels: If the issue isn’t resolved through standard customer care, escalate the matter using official consumer protection channels.

Additional Tips for Avoiding Future Issues

  • Research Before Buying:
    Check reviews and ratings of the seller, and look for any reports of similar issues from other buyers.
  • Verify Product Details:
    Ensure that the product description, images, and model numbers match what you expect before making a purchase.
  • Use Secure Payment Methods:
    Payment methods that offer buyer protection can be very useful in case you need to dispute a charge.
